The average salary for Australian Environmental Scientists is currently $2,250 per week ($117,000 annually). These are median figures that include the salaries for new graduates as well as experienced scientists.

There are approximately 26,300 Environmental Scientists employed in Australia right now. They work for construction companies, energy and resources corporations, conservation organisations, academic institutions, government departments and agencies such as the Environmental Protection Authority (EPA), the CSIRO, and the Department of Environment, Land, Water and Planning. Some Environmental Scientists are self-employed consultants.

To work as an Environmental Scientist in Australia you will need a Bachelor of Science (Earth and Environmental Systems) or Bachelor of Environmental Science and Management. You will also benefit from post-graduate studies in a specialist field such as climate and weather, agriculture, plant and soil management, fisheries, oceanography, ecology, geology, and more.
